Genetic Technologies Launches BREVAGenplus® Marketing Program
Around Susan G. Komen®s Race for the Cure® Events
Melbourne, Australia, 3 October 2016: Molecular diagnostics company Genetic Technologies Limited (ASX: GTG; NASDAQ: GENE; Company) announced today that it will be conducting a promotional campaign around the Susan G. Komen Race for the Cure events. This program will commence at the Susan G. Komen Dallas Race for the Cure in Dallas, on October 15 2016, which coincides with National Breast Cancer Awareness Month. Two contests will anchor the initiative and will feature, in person, BREVAGenplus spokesperson and Susan G. Komen advocate, Verizon IndyCar series driver, Pippa Mann.
We are pleased to join Susan G. Komen in the worlds largest fundraising initiative to fight breast cancer, commented Mr. Eutillio Buccilli, Chief Executive Officer of Genetic Technologies Limited. By participating at these Race for the Cure events we reaffirm our commitment to supporting the important work Komen does on behalf of the breast cancer community. We are pleased to have Pippa on site in Dallas for this Race to help us raise awareness of the importance risk assessment plays in the prevention and early detection of the disease.
Participants who visit the BREVAGenplus booth, which will be located in the Sponsor Expo Area, south of the Main Stage, will be encouraged to fill out the BREVAGenplus Quiz at that time, and will be entered to win an iPad mini. Pippa will be present at the booth to greet participants and to discuss the threat represented by breast cancer and the importance of risk assessment, especially for women with little to no family history. Breast cancer will affect 1 in 8 women during their lifetime. In parallel, the Company will be conducting a social media contest whereby the first 100 participants will receive a signed Pippa Mann poster. In order to enter the contest, participants need to re-tweet or share one of BREVAGenplus social media posts or use the hashtag #KnowYourRisk.
About Genetic Technologies Limited
Genetic Technologies is a molecular diagnostics company that offers predictive testing and assessment tools to help physicians proactively manage womens health. The Companys lead product, BREVAGenplus®, is a clinically validated risk assessment test for non-hereditary breast cancer and is first in its class. BREVAGenplus® improves upon the predictive power of the first generation BREVAGen test and is designed to facilitate better informed decisions about breast cancer screening and preventive treatment plans. BREVAGenplus® expands the application of BREVAGen from Caucasian women to include African-Americans and Hispanics, and is directed towards women aged 35 years or above, who have not had breast cancer and have one or more risk factors for developing breast cancer.
The Company has successfully launched the first generation BREVAGen test across the U.S. via its U.S. subsidiary Phenogen Sciences Inc. and the addition of BREVAGenplus®, launched in October 2014,

About Susan G. Komen® and Susan G. Komen® Dallas County
Susan G. Komen is the worlds largest breast cancer organization, funding more breast cancer research than any other nonprofit outside of the federal government while providing real-time help to those facing the disease. Komen was founded in 1982 by Nancy G. Brinker, who promised her sister, Susan G. Komen, that she would end the disease that claimed Suzys life. Komen Dallas County is working to better the lives of those facing breast cancer in the local community. Through events like the Komen Dallas Race for the Cure, Komen Dallas County has invested over $24 million in community breast health programs in Dallas County and has contributed to the more than $920 million invested globally in research.
